Diverse Visions


2024 Erasmus+ training course for youth workers and teachers who are interested in digital storytelling and working with young people who are neurodivergent.

ARTicipate


2023-2025 Erasmus+ KA2 long-term project aimed to promote innovative and engaging methodologies for adult learners at risk of exclusion.

Picture the Change


2023-2024 Erasmus + project aiming at promoting participatory photography as a method for supporting young people at risk.

DigiStorID

2018-2021 Erasmus+ project aiming to adapt the method of Digital Storytelling to people with intellectual disabillities.

Richard Posthumus

Richard first started getting associated with facilitation of projects in 2018, improving his skills and competences ever since. His biggest passion comes from his interest in storytelling which gets expressed in writing, drawing, filmmaking and photography. With these 10+ projects under his belt, he has accumulated a broad international network which he keeps in contact with for future collaborations. Currently working in a different field, his heart lies in non-formal education and spends any free time into exploring that field more and more often.

Richard is board member of Upstream Stories.
